Understanding AI-Driven User Intent Prediction

AI-driven user intent prediction is an advanced methodology that leverages machine learning and data analytics to forecast what a user is likely to search for or explore next. This predictive approach involves analyzing vast datasets—ranging from search history and social media activity to real-time browsing behavior. The ultimate goal is to understand not only what users are doing, but why they are doing it, thereby enabling the creation of highly tailored content that addresses the specific needs, questions, and desires of the audience.

A key factor in this process is the use of natural language processing (NLP), which interprets the nuances and context of user queries. By interpreting both direct searches and the subtler signals—such as the sentiment behind a comment—AI systems can refine their predictions and present highly targeted content recommendations. This method of contextualizing data not only boosts engagement but also drives conversion rates, making it an indispensable tool in the marketer's toolkit.

Integrating AI in Website Promotion: Best Practices

Step 1: Data Collection and Analysis

The journey begins with robust data collection. For businesses looking to enhance website promotion via AI systems, the quality of data is paramount. A diversity of data sources—from customer relationship management systems and social media channels to direct user feedback—will enhance the predictive power of AI. Data analysts must ensure that data is cleansed, normalized, and enriched before feeding it into AI algorithms.

Modern analytics tools enable businesses to track customer behavior in a highly granular manner. After analyzing interactions, the next step is to segment the audience properly, thereby tailoring content recommendations to each segment's specific needs.

Step 2: AI Model Selection and Training

A crucial element in deploying AI is selecting the right model for intent prediction. There are many AI frameworks available, each with its own set of advantages. When integrated with content planning and website promotion, these models require training on relevant data sets to accurately predict trends in user behavior.

For instance, deep learning models can analyze complex patterns in user behavior and adjust predictions in real time. Over time, as the model is exposed to new data, its predictive accuracy improves—leading to content strategies that become increasingly effective at engaging the audience. Challenges in AI-Driven Content Planning

Like any transformative technology, AI-driven content planning is not without its challenges. Foremost among these is the issue of data privacy. With massive quantities of personal user data involved, marketers must navigate regulatory frameworks and ensure that user data is handled with the utmost care and transparency.

Another inherent challenge is the complexity of integrating AI systems into existing content workflows. It requires a concerted effort from multiple departments—data scientists, content creators, and marketing strategists—to seamlessly incorporate AI predictions into the creative process. Moreover, while AI models are immensely powerful, they are not infallible. Continuous oversight, regular training, and the capacity to pivot when trends diverge are essential.

Practical Examples of Integrating AI Into Website Promotion

Let’s consider a practical scenario: A travel website seeks to increase user retention by predicting the travel interests of potential customers. By using AI to analyze browsing history, search queries, and social media trends, the system can recommend personalized travel itineraries, suggest hidden travel gems, and even trigger time-sensitive promotions. The resulting content cascade leads to enhanced user engagement and drives higher conversion rates, all while building a stronger, data-driven brand identity.

Another example is seen in the domain of e-learning. Educational platforms can deploy AI to analyze student progress and content engagement, predicting which topics may require additional resources or alternative presentation styles. The applied predictive analytics not only optimize the user experience but also empower educators to design curricula that are both comprehensive and adaptive.
